Since its founding in 1995, Powersoft has been at the forefront of innovation in energy-efficient, high-power compact amplifiers for the pro-audio industry. The company takes pride in delivering cutting-edge audio systems that blend exceptional quality with unparalleled efficiency, serving clients across the globe.
With a strong commitment to R&D, Powersoft continuously pushes the boundaries of audio technology, earning numerous patents and prestigious awards along the way.
Today, the company is proud to have over 150 talented employees distributed across the US, China, and Japan, along with a worldwide sales network featuring service centers in over 80 countries. Its production combines state-of-the-art in-house manufacturing with carefully selected suppliers, ensuring top-notch quality at every step.
